Default Independent CDL schools in Dallas?

Can anyone recommend a good independent CDL training school in or near Dallas TX? I dont think I want to go the company sponsored route, too many bad stories...

Also, are govt grants available to assist with the cost of school? If so, can you provide a link?

Yes, government $ is avail for training, in general. In my state you just had to be collecting unemployment, and u were eligible for $. I got my whole 6 weeks paid for, at a local community college. Finally, some socialism for me instead of someone else. !

The county colleges are good for training, as opposed to a private training school, I hear.
I was happy with the training I got at the county college.

I am about to graduate from an independent school here in NC. I had my school paid for through the Army's Tuition Assistance because I am still Active Duty Army (I go weekends only)
A couple of guys in my class had their school paid for through Workforce Development, might want to look into that. The school also finances.
